Python过滤掉numpy.array中非nan数据实例


Posted in Python onJune 08, 2020

代码

需要先导入pandas

arr的数据类型为一维的np.array

import pandas as pd
arr[~pd.isnull(arr)]

补充知识:python numpy.mean() axis参数使用方法【sum(axis=*)是求和,mean(axis=*)是求平均值】

如下所示:

import numpy as np
X = np.array([[1, 2], [4, 5], [7, 8]])
print(np.mean(X, axis=0, keepdims=True))
print('*'*50)
print(np.mean(X, axis=1, keepdims=True))
print('*'*50)
print(X.mean(axis=0))
print('*'*50)
print(X.mean(axis=1))

[[4. 5.]]

[[1.5]
[4.5]
[7.5]]

[4. 5.]

[1.5 4.5 7.5]

20200221

np.mean()还可计算列表元素均值:

import numpy as np
list1=[1,2,3,4,5]
list2=[[1,2,3],[4,5,6]]
print(np.mean(list1))
print(np.mean(list2))

结果:

3.0
3.5

以上这篇Python过滤掉numpy.array中非nan数据实例就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
用Python的urllib库提交WEB表单
Feb 24 Python
Python 转义字符详细介绍
Mar 21 Python
基于Python和Scikit-Learn的机器学习探索
Oct 16 Python
python pandas 组内排序、单组排序、标号的实例
Apr 12 Python
python pandas库中DataFrame对行和列的操作实例讲解
Jun 09 Python
Python 3.3实现计算两个日期间隔秒数/天数的方法示例
Jan 07 Python
Python PIL图片添加字体的例子
Aug 22 Python
Python统计分析模块statistics用法示例
Sep 06 Python
Python读取csv文件实例解析
Dec 30 Python
解决pycharm不能自动补全第三方库的函数和属性问题
Mar 12 Python
python中的split、rsplit、splitlines用法说明
Oct 23 Python
Pandas中DataFrame交换列顺序的方法实现
Dec 14 Python
使用Python FastAPI构建Web服务的实现
Jun 08 #Python
python爬虫把url链接编码成gbk2312格式过程解析
Jun 08 #Python
给ubuntu18安装python3.7的详细教程
Jun 08 #Python
Python 实现将numpy中的nan和inf,nan替换成对应的均值
Jun 08 #Python
使用Numpy对特征中的异常值进行替换及条件替换方式
Jun 08 #Python
Python替换NumPy数组中大于某个值的所有元素实例
Jun 08 #Python
python如何编写win程序
Jun 08 #Python
You might like
Cappuccino 卡布其诺咖啡之制作
2021/03/03 冲泡冲煮
PHP4和PHP5共存于一系统
2006/11/17 PHP
PHP实现用户认证及管理完全源码
2007/03/11 PHP
Php无限级栏目分类读取的实现代码
2014/02/19 PHP
在Yii框架中使用PHP模板引擎Twig的例子
2014/06/13 PHP
javascript实现二分查找法实现代码
2007/11/12 Javascript
模拟jQuery ajax服务器端与客户端通信的代码
2011/03/28 Javascript
JS 实现点击a标签的时候让其背景更换
2013/10/15 Javascript
用javascript添加控件自定义属性解析
2013/11/25 Javascript
Jquery实现瀑布流布局(备有详细注释)
2015/07/31 Javascript
禁用backspace网页回退功能的实现代码
2016/11/15 Javascript
vue添加class样式实例讲解
2019/02/12 Javascript
微信小程序实现商城倒计时
2020/11/01 Javascript
vue实现Excel文件的上传与下载功能的两种方式
2019/06/28 Javascript
浅析Vue 防抖与节流的使用
2019/11/14 Javascript
vue props 单项数据流实例分享
2020/02/16 Javascript
[51:28]EG vs Mineski 2018国际邀请赛小组赛BO2 第一场 8.16
2018/08/16 DOTA
Python实现登录接口的示例代码
2017/07/21 Python
ERLANG和PYTHON互通实现过程详解
2019/07/05 Python
10行Python代码计算汽车数量的实现方法
2019/10/23 Python
python3获取文件中url内容并下载代码实例
2019/12/27 Python
解决jupyter notebook显示不全出现框框或者乱码问题
2020/04/09 Python
解决jupyter notebook 前面书写后面内容消失的问题
2020/04/13 Python
无需压缩软件,用python帮你操作压缩包
2020/08/17 Python
Original Penguin英国官方网站:美国著名休闲时装品牌
2016/10/30 全球购物
凯特·丝蓓英国官网:Kate Spade英国
2016/11/07 全球购物
波兰最大的儿童服装连锁店之一:5.10.15.
2018/02/11 全球购物
初中生物教学反思
2014/01/10 职场文书
网络工程师自荐书范文
2014/04/01 职场文书
交通事故私了协议书
2014/04/16 职场文书
小学学校评估方案
2014/06/08 职场文书
学校总务处领导班子民主生活会对照检查材料思想汇报
2014/09/27 职场文书
机关党员三严三实心得体会
2014/10/13 职场文书
捐款仪式主持词
2015/07/04 职场文书
教你怎么用PyCharm为同一服务器配置多个python解释器
2021/05/31 Python
SpringBoot整合minio快速入门教程(代码示例)
2022/04/03 Java/Android